Ingredients

Riz cuit 47% (eau, riz), oignon 10%, jambon cuit standard fumé 9% (jambon de porc, eau, sirop de glucose, sel, dextrose, arômes naturels, antioxydant : érythorbate de sodium, conservateur : nitrite de sodium), omelette 9% (_oeuf_ entier, eau, farine de _blé_, jus de citron, sel, épaississant : gomme xanthane, curcuma, poivre), carotte 7%, petits pois 6%, huile de tournesol, champignon noir 3%, sucre, sel, huile de _sésame_ grillé, poivre

Allergens

eggs, gluten, sesame seeds
